From b8e94316e41eba72d927d5ca7d931b26139ee8ff Mon Sep 17 00:00:00 2001 From: wxr <464027401@qq.com> Date: 星期一, 15 六月 2020 09:12:53 +0800 Subject: [PATCH] 20200612 --- HDL_ON/UI/UI2/4-PersonalCenter/UnlockSetting/AppUnlockPasswordPage.cs | 50 ++++++++++++++++++++++++++++++-------------------- 1 files changed, 30 insertions(+), 20 deletions(-) diff --git a/HDL_ON/UI/UI2/4-PersonalCenter/UnlockSetting/AppUnlockPasswordPage.cs b/HDL_ON/UI/UI2/4-PersonalCenter/UnlockSetting/AppUnlockPasswordPage.cs index 7321820..f9d5e08 100644 --- a/HDL_ON/UI/UI2/4-PersonalCenter/UnlockSetting/AppUnlockPasswordPage.cs +++ b/HDL_ON/UI/UI2/4-PersonalCenter/UnlockSetting/AppUnlockPasswordPage.cs @@ -137,10 +137,12 @@ Y = Application.GetRealWidth(100), Height = Application.GetRealWidth(10), Foucs = true, - Visible = false, + //Visible = false, IsNumberKeyboardType = true, }; bodyView.AddChidren(etPassword); + + //etPassword.MouseUpEventHandler = (sender, e) => { }; etPassword.TextChangeEventHandler = (sender, e) => { passwrod = etPassword.Text.Trim(); @@ -176,25 +178,26 @@ btnTipIcon2.IsSelected = true; btnTipIcon3.IsSelected = true; btnTipIcon4.IsSelected = true; + Application.HideSoftInput(); if (string.IsNullOrEmpty(oldPasswrod)) { + //绉婚櫎褰撳墠鐣岄潰锛屾瘡娆¤繑鍥為兘杩斿洖鍒版渶涓婄骇 + this.RemoveFromParent(); var page = new AppUnlockPasswordPage(passwrod,backAction); MainPage.BasePageView.AddChidren(page); page.LoadPage(optionType); MainPage.BasePageView.PageIndex = MainPage.BasePageView.ChildrenCount - 1; - //绉婚櫎褰撳墠鐣岄潰锛屾瘡娆¤繑鍥為兘杩斿洖鍒版渶涓婄骇 - MainPage.BasePageView.RemoveAt(MainPage.BasePageView.ChildrenCount - 2); } else { - if(optionType == "2") + if (optionType == "2") { + //绉婚櫎褰撳墠鐣岄潰锛屾瘡娆¤繑鍥為兘杩斿洖鍒版渶涓婄骇 + this.RemoveFromParent(); var page = new AppUnlockPasswordPage("", backAction); MainPage.BasePageView.AddChidren(page); page.LoadPage("1"); MainPage.BasePageView.PageIndex = MainPage.BasePageView.ChildrenCount - 1; - //绉婚櫎褰撳墠鐣岄潰锛屾瘡娆¤繑鍥為兘杩斿洖鍒版渶涓婄骇 - MainPage.BasePageView.RemoveAt(MainPage.BasePageView.ChildrenCount - 2); return; } @@ -280,30 +283,35 @@ this.RemoveFromParent(); var page = new OperationResultDisPalyPage(); page.Show(); + page.LoadPage(true, Language.StringByID(StringId.SetSuccessfully), Language.StringByID(StringId.SetSuccessfully), ""); string tipMsg = TouchIDUtils.getTouchIDSupperType() == TouchIDUtils.TouchIDSupperType.TouchID ? Language.StringByID(StringId.TurnOnFingerprintUnlocking) : Language.StringByID(StringId.TurnOnFaceIdUnlocking); - Action<bool> action = (result) => + + if (TouchIDUtils.getTouchIDSupperType() != TouchIDUtils.TouchIDSupperType.None) { var unlockType = TouchIDUtils.getTouchIDSupperType() == TouchIDUtils.TouchIDSupperType.TouchID ? "3" : "4"; - if (result) + Action<bool> action = (result) => { - if (!MainPage.LoginUser.appUnlockType.Contains(unlockType)) + if (result) { - MainPage.LoginUser.appUnlockType.Add(unlockType); + if (!MainPage.LoginUser.appUnlockType.Contains(unlockType)) + { + MainPage.LoginUser.appUnlockType.Add(unlockType); + } } - } - else - { - if (MainPage.LoginUser.appUnlockType.Contains(unlockType)) + else { - MainPage.LoginUser.appUnlockType.Remove(unlockType); + if (MainPage.LoginUser.appUnlockType.Contains(unlockType)) + { + MainPage.LoginUser.appUnlockType.Remove(unlockType); + } } - } - backAction(); - MainPage.LoginUser.SaveUserInfo(); - }; - page.AdditionalOperations(tipMsg, action); + backAction(); + MainPage.LoginUser.SaveUserInfo(); + }; + page.AdditionalOperations(tipMsg, action); + } if (!MainPage.LoginUser.appUnlockType.Contains("1")) { MainPage.LoginUser.appUnlockType.Add("1"); @@ -331,6 +339,8 @@ btnTipIcon2.MouseUpEventHandler = eventHandler; btnTipIcon3.MouseUpEventHandler = eventHandler; btnTipIcon4.MouseUpEventHandler = eventHandler; + + etPassword.Foucs = true; } } } -- Gitblit v1.8.0